Output 3d96158dd22093640ee4230068cee9f04e30051067188fd9051fe8b6872953e8:10

value
12826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32063df3c2d07b825606e445af5d551307fb8aa3 OP_EQUAL
address
36FXBqWDy9YbKTH68oSwC9JBxpScGCKzr5
transaction
3d96158dd22093640ee4230068cee9f04e30051067188fd9051fe8b6872953e8
spent
true